Hey guys! Ever been stuck in a movie theater, popcorn in hand, and thought, "Wow, this is intense"? Well, buckle up, because The Hurricane Heist is one of those movies. It's a high-octane action flick that cranks up the tension with a massive hurricane as its backdrop. This ain't your average heist movie; we're talking about a storm so big it becomes a major plot device, adding a whole new level of chaos to the mix. The storyline revolves around a group of thieves who plan a daring raid on the US Treasury, taking advantage of a Category 5 hurricane. As if the storm wasn't bad enough, our heroes, and should I say, the heroes of the movie, have to deal with the relentless weather, the highly skilled criminals, and a race against time to save not just themselves but also the fate of the nation.
